    New Twitter Update: “Professional Accounts” are now available to all users

    0
    By Smart Megwai on March 30, 2022 Social Media, Technology, Twitter

    Twitter is rolling out the Professional Profiles option to users who care to have a “unique and clearly defined presence on the platform.” The new upgrade will allow any user to convert his or her account to a Professional Profile right there within the settings. Now, all Twitter users can go through the conversion process in their account settings, which opens up a whole new set of features, like a new business information display, product listings, and so on.

    After a few brands agreed to be beta testers for Twitter’s Professional Profiles in April last year, they were able to use them for the first time. As a result, Twitter started inviting more businesses to sign up. In September, it opened it up to everyone else. Now, you don’t have to get Twitter’s permission to change your profile. You can choose to have a Professional Profile or not in your profile options.

    However, there are a few caveats to consider. These rules must be followed to qualify for a Professional Account.

    • You must not have a history of repeatedly violating the Twitter User Agreement
    • You must have a complete profile with an account name, a bio, and a profile picture
    • Your authentic identity must be clear on your profile. Your profile must not feature another person’s identity, brand, or organization, nor does it use a fake identity intended to deceive others. Profiles that feature animals or fictional characters are ineligible unless directly affiliated with your brand or organization. Parody and fan accounts are not eligible for Professional Accounts.

    It’s important to keep these rules in mind to avoid being imitated. But if you don’t want to do that, you can sign up and try out the new listings. Your in-app listing could be an excellent approach to boost engagement with your business or, at the very least, increase your brand’s visibility. Either way, it seems like a worthwhile experiment – and you can always switch your account back to a personal profile if you don’t like the results.

    To convert your Twitter profile to a Professional Account:

    • Go to either your profile settings or swipe open the sidebar when on your Home timeline in the app. If you’re in the sidebar, scroll until you see the “Twitter for Professionals” tab and select it. If you’re in your profile settings, scroll until you see “Switch to Professional” and select it
    • Once you’ve entered the conversion flow, select “Get Started”
    • Select a category for your Professional Account and select “Next” 
    • Choose either “Business” or “Creator” and select “Next” 
    • Congratulations! You are now a Professional on Twitter!
